Applying Porter’s Five Forces to South Korea’s Medical Power Supply Market
Analyzing competitive forces reveals a high threat of new entrants due to technological advancements and government incentives, balanced by significant capital requirements and regulatory hurdles. Supplier power remains moderate, with a few dominant component manufacturers controlling critical parts like batteries and converters. Buyer power is elevated, as healthcare providers seek cost-effective, reliable solutions amid budget constraints. The threat of substitutes is low but growing with the advent of alternative energy storage and backup systems.
Competitive rivalry is intense, driven by innovation cycles and the race for technological leadership. Companies investing in R&D and strategic alliances are better positioned to capture market share. Overall, the market’s profitability hinges on technological differentiation, regulatory compliance, and the ability to adapt to evolving healthcare standards.

Impact of Regulatory and Policy Frameworks on Market Development
South Korea’s government actively promotes energy efficiency and sustainability in healthcare through policies and incentives. Regulations favor the adoption of low-emission, energy-saving power systems, encouraging hospitals and diagnostic centers to upgrade their infrastructure. Certification standards for medical-grade power supplies ensure safety, reliability, and interoperability, fostering market confidence.
Policy initiatives supporting renewable energy integration, such as subsidies for solar and fuel cell systems, directly influence market growth. Additionally, digital health policies emphasizing smart hospital infrastructure incentivize the deployment of IoT-enabled power management solutions. These regulatory frameworks create a conducive environment for innovation, investment, and international competitiveness, shaping the future trajectory of the sector.
